Sensex rallied by 385.04 points

| @indiablooms | Sep 07, 2023, at 10:47 pm

Mumbai/UNI: The BSE Sensex on Thursday surged 385.04 pts to close at 66,265.56 in a volatile trade, following gains in Capital Goods, Realty, Industrials and Energy stocks.

The Nifty gained 116 pts at 19,727.05 pts.

The Sensex opened negative at 65,858.42, easing 22 pts. It slipped 208 pts at 65,672.34, days low. Later, it bounced back nearly 416 pts at 66,296.90, days high, before closing at 66,265.56, up 385.04 pts from its previous close.

In stocks, Capital Goods was a major gainer, up 2.29 pc followed by Industrials by 1.55 pc, Realty by 1.44 pc and Energy by 0.96 pc.

The Mid Cap moved up by 0.79 pc and Small Cap by 0.40 pc.

In 30 scrips, 20 advanced while 10 declined.

The gainers were L& T by 4.19 pc to Rs 2845, IndusInd Bank by 2.05 pc to Rs 1437, SBI by 1.82 pc to Rs 580.85, Tech Mahindra by 1.61 pc to Rs 1268.30 and HCL Technologies by 1.56 pc to Rs 1255

The losers were Sun Pharma by 0.88 pc to Rs 1132.20, Infosys by 0.66 pc to Rs 1467, M&M by 0.65 pc to Rs 1567.50 and Ultracemco by 0.59 pc to Rs 8483.
